I have a laptop which I use mainly for watching movies, and I'm thinking about upgrading my 2.1 speaker system to one that has bluetooth capabilities (A2DP & AVRCP). No wires around my laptop would make it easier to move around my room. But will I be able to watch movies using the bluetooth-connected speakers with good audio quality?


Answer
Bluetooth is a digital interface. Provided it has enough bandwidth for digital audio (2-ch is about 1.5 Mbit/s) and there are no drops due to distance, a digital interface has nothing to do with audio quality. Audio quality depends on the quality of the speakers.

To move around your room, you still need power. If you use the battery, most laptops run at lower speed to preserve energy, and that may cause playback problems. Having a blue-tooth transmitter, means even more power drain from your battery. So, do test first your laptop in battery mode.
